What is a CT Scan?
A commonly used diagnostic imaging technique, CT (Computerized Tomography) scan combines a sequence of X-ray images captured from varying angles and utilises computer processing to generate cross-sectional images of the bones, blood vessels & soft tissues.

Ideal for quickly examining people who have suffered internal injuries or some kind of trauma, a CT Scan offers a much more comprehensive overview than a regular X-ray.

It can be utilised to visualise almost all body parts and is generally used to diagnose disease/injury in addition to helping plan medical, surgical or radiation treatment.

How does a CT Scan work?
The CT Scan is based on ...
... the x-ray principle. It involves combining a series of x-ray images taken from various angles and then utilising a blend of complex hardware & software technologies to generate 3D images of the internal organs​ and body structures.

The 3D images have a high contrast ratio between bone, tissue, blood vessels & other body parts. These images are stored as electronic data files and generally examined on a computer. A radiologist evaluates these images before sending a report to the doctor.

When should we do a CT Scan?
A doctor or health practitioner usually recommends a CT Scan to help:

Cases of bowel perforation, head / body trauma
Identify the location of a tumour, infection or blood clot
Guide procedures like surgery, biopsy & radiation therapy
Detect & monitor diseases and conditions like cancer, heart disease, lung nodules & liver masses
Monitor the effectiveness of specific treatments, like cancer treatment
Identify internal injuries & fractures.
